Transaction 82da852778a3e77805e9335a2ba8de78c468b3f72a5a2a6dc106482117066275
1 Input
1 Output
-
82da852778a3e77805e9335a2ba8de78c468b3f72a5a2a6dc106482117066275:0
- value
- 1981905
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7307f8ef8dbe58841f1260ed3d882e7eca09ec7a OP_EQUAL
- address
- 3CBFBY5f1yVPiWzf3SMsL8ka4ddH5xwAUX